10 000 Durham students to receive take-home Chromebooks for school use

10 000 students in the Durham school board will receive take home Chromebooks following a successful pilot project. DDSB District principal for technology, media and libraries, joins to talk more about the project.

Financial Accountability Office of Ontario releases report reviewing 2017 revenue outlook

Today the FAO will be releasing a commentary to reviews the government’s revenue outlook in the 2017 Budget. David West is the Chief Economist of the FAO and he joins Tasha to give an overview of the report.

Motorola patents “self fixing” phone technology

Motorola has patented a new technology that wold allow a broken phone screen to fix itself. Rose Behar is a senior reporter at Mobile Syrup, she joins to talk more about this technology, and if we are likely to see it soon.
